Garden Learning Center Internship

Internship Program Highlights

 
 

Mentorship and Leadership Training

Interns will be mentored by the leadership team at Garden Learning Center. They'll glean valuable, practical skills & experience for college applications, work resumes, and future internships. Students will have opportunities to develop custom projects that tap into their strengths and passions.

 
 

Paid Internship

Interns will be paid a stipend of $600.

 
 

Letters of Recommendation

Contingent on performing outstanding work at Garden Learning Center, each intern will receive a strong letter of recommendation at the end of their internship from a member of our leadership team. We value our interns and are committed to supporting them in their career and college aspirations.

 
 

Community Service Hours

Interns have the opportunity to earn community service hours for their participation in Garden Learning Center.

 
 
 

College Credit

College credit approval is subject to the interns’ respective university’s course credit requirement for internships. It is the interns’ responsibility to get this internship pre-approved by their academic advisor.

 

Internship Qualifications

 
  • College & High School students -9th Grade & Up

  • Must be available for the entire semester. Sessions are held on Tuesdays and Thursdays from 4-6pm

  • Prior experience working with kids/students 

  • Experience in tutoring a plus

 

Internship Roles and Responsibilities

 
  • Attend and participate in all mandatory trainings, meetings, etc.

  • Tutor students from 4th-8th grade in math and language arts

  • Partner with academic coaches in motivating and guiding students

  • Develop leadership skills and teamwork through planning/assisting in enrichment activities, events, and other special projects

  • Assist in prep, setup, and clean up

  • Supervise and engage with students during snack time

  • Cultivate encouraging relationships with students | Serve as positive role model to students
